How to Facetime Android?

FaceTime is one of the most reliable ways to video chat with Apple users. If you happen to own any one of the products, iPhone, iPad, or Mac, it is understandable if you take FaceTime for granted.

Unfortunately, there is no option for an Android user to download the FaceTime app or the option to start a FaceTime call. However, thanks to the release of iOS 15, iPadOS 15, and the macOS Monterey, anyone can join a FaceTime call using their web browser.

This article will show you how to send a FaceTime invite from an Apple product, it will also how to join FaceTime calls if you have an Android phone.

How to join a FaceTime call on an Android device or a PC?

Android, as well as Windows users, do not have the ability to start FaceTime calls. However, if you have the latest version of Google Chrome or Microsoft Edge installed on your device, you will be able to join FaceTime calls that Apple users create.

Tip – Google Chrome is pre-installed on the majority of Android phones, while the Microsoft Edge browser comes pre-installed on all Windows PCs.

First, an Apple device user needs to start a FaceTime call. To do so, they have to have:

An iPhone running at least iOS 15, or an iPad running at least iPadOS 15. If not, then a Mac running at least macOS Monterey.

1. The Apple user has to open the FaceTime app on their device, then tap on Create Link at the top of the app.

2. A pop-up will appear; the Apple user must select how they would like to share this link. The options for sharing are via Messages, Mail, AirDrop, or another app. The method they choose will not matter as the Android or PC user just requires the link.

3. After the Android or Windows user receives the FaceTime link, they can open it in Google Chrome or Microsoft Edge.

4. The Android/Windows user will have to enter their name, then tap Continue.

5. Then the Android/Windows user hits the green Join button in the pop-up. FaceTime does require permission to use the microphone and camera.

6. The Apple user will then accept the request to join.

7. After both parties enter the call, they will both see the same options, such as the option to mute themselves, show or hide their camera, leave the call, etc.

Are Android users able to initiate a FaceTime call?

No. FaceTime is an Apple-exclusive service, which means that Android users can only join FaceTime calls initiated by Apple users.
